The arrangement is intended to help bases strengthen energy resilience, improve infrastructure management, and prepare for operational disruptions.
Managing aging utility systems A major focus of the Army agreement is the condition and performance of utility infrastructure at military installations.
“National security requires energy and water surety,” said Nancy J. Balkus, deputy assistant secretary of the Air Force for infrastructure, energy and environment.
Supporting long-term installation resilience Intergovernmental Support Agreements allow military installations to obtain support services from eligible state and local government entities.
The initiative also aligns with wider efforts to ensure military installations can continue meeting mission requirements as energy systems, infrastructure demands, and operating environments evolve.
